Frequent DIY Plumbing Errors to Steer Clear Of
A large number of homeowners fail to grasp the intricacies of plumbing, causing frequent DIY blunders. A frequent error is the improper use of instruments, which can compromise plumbing components. Many also forget to turn off the water supply before initiating repairs, leading to flooding and unexpected complications. Misjudging the severity of leaks often produces temporary fixes that fail, creating more serious issues over time.
Another common error is selecting improper sealants or adhesives, which can degrade under pressure or temperature changes. Homeowners often neglect local plumbing codes, potentially facing fines or hazardous installations. Furthermore, failing to adequately assess the problem can cause ineffective repair attempts, squandering valuable time and financial resources. In many cases, these errors could readily be prevented by consulting a professional plumber, who holds the skills and knowledge to address plumbing issues effectively and efficiently from the start.
The Hidden Costs of DIY Plumbing Repairs
While DIY plumbing repairs may initially seem cost-effective, homeowners commonly underestimate concealed costs that can result from these undertakings. To begin with, acquiring equipment and materials can accumulate into significant costs, especially if specialized equipment is required. These financial burdens can be further increased if the homeowner needs to purchase materials more than once due to inaccurate measurements or calculation errors.
Furthermore, many DIY repairs can unexpectedly result in further damage, driving up repair costs. To illustrate, an improperly fixed leak might result in water damage, mold growth, or structural issues that require professional intervention. Homeowners may also experience time losses, as untrained individuals might spend significantly longer on repairs than originally planned.
Finally, the lack of warranties or guarantees on DIY work can cause future expenses if complications reappear. In general, what initially appears to be a cost-effective approach can evolve into a significant financial burden, making hiring a professional plumber a more prudent investment in the overall scheme of things.

The Reasons Plumbing Codes Are Essential for Your Safety?
Adhering to plumbing codes is critical for guaranteeing safety and functionality in any plumbing system. These codes are designed to minimize dangers connected to plumbing installations, handling potential concerns such as leaks, water contamination, and structural damage. Compliance with these regulations assures that methods and materials used in plumbing are verified and confirmed to be safe.
When plumbing standards are observed, the likelihood of expensive repairs and health concerns diminishes significantly. As an illustration, improper drainage can lead to stagnant water, promoting mold proliferation and presenting health dangers. Moreover, standards necessitate appropriate venting systems to eliminate hazardous gas buildup.
Engaging a professional plumber who has knowledge of these codes guarantees that installations are performed correctly, minimizing the risk of unsafe circumstances. In the end, compliance with plumbing codes not only protects the integrity of the plumbing system but also safeguards the well-being of residents, making it a crucial component of any plumbing endeavor.

Tips for Hiring the Right Plumber
Finding the most suitable plumber can significantly determine the quality and expense of residential repairs, especially when plumbing issues emerge without warning. To secure a successful search process, residents should initiate the process by researching nearby plumbing specialists. Online reviews and suggestions from trusted friends and family can supply important details.
Additionally, it is crucial to verify proper certifications and coverage. A licensed plumber should possess the appropriate licenses and maintain coverage to guard against potential losses. Moreover, requesting multiple estimates can enable homeowners to compare prices and services.
Effective communication is equally important; a skilled plumber ought to clearly explain the issue and recommended solutions. Additionally, request references to assess their dependability and quality of work. By following these tips, homeowners can confidently select a plumber who meets their needs and guarantees quality repairs, ultimately saving both time and money.

What Are the Most Common Indicators of Plumbing Issues in My Home?
Typical indicators of plumbing problems consist of slow drains, water stains on ceilings or walls, unusual noises from pipes, fluctuating water pressure, and persistent odors. Recognizing these symptoms early can prevent more significant damage and costly repairs.
